ADnister’s Annual General Meeting in Novemberwe proudly unveiled a new chapter for our organisation: a new name and refreshed identity as Dnister Bank. From Monday 16th Marchour new name and look will replace current branding for Dnister Ukrainian Credit Co-operative Ltd. 

Our refreshed brand continues to honour Dnister’s Ukrainian and Latvian heritage, while positioning us for growth and sustained success. It reflects who we are today: a trusted, values-led, member-owned bank committed to helping our members and communities thrive.

While Dnister’s look will evolve, what matters most remains unchanged – our people, our service, and our dedication to every member. There will be no impact on member accounts oraccess and members do not need to do anything.

When will the change happen and what will this look like?

From 16th March, you’ll start seeing the Dnister Bank name and refreshed branding across: 

  • Our website, online banking and app

  • Member statements and communications

  • Emails and social media channels

  • In-branch materials

 

What does this mean for members?

There will be no impact on member accounts, access or services beyond a new look. Members don’t need to do anything and can continue banking with us exactly as you do today.

Cards and payments 

There will be no changes to existing Visa Debit Cards, and members can continue using their current cards as normal. When your card expires, you’ll be issued a new Visa Debit Card in the new Dnister Bank branding, with the option to choose between a Ukrainian- or Latvian-inspired design.  

If you have your Visa Debit Card saved in a digital wallet (such as Apple Pay or Google Pay), it will continue to work as normal and members do not need to take any action. In future, instructions will be provided if you would like to update your digital card to the new brand, but this is not a functional requirement. 

Cheques and Cue Cards will not be rebranded and will be decommissioned in the near future – further information on this as well as alternatives to ensure a smooth transition will be communicatedin advance. Members can continue using their current cheques and Cue Cards in the meantime.
